Sanskrit Original
र॒श्मीँरि॑व यच्छतमध्व॒राँ उप॑ श्या॒वाश्व॑स्य सुन्व॒तो म॑दच्युता । स॒जोष॑सा उ॒षसा॒ सूर्ये॑ण॒ चाश्वि॑ना ति॒रोअ॑ह्न्यम्
raśmīm̐riva yacchatamadhvarām̐ upa śyāvāśvasya sunvato madacyutā sajoṣasā uṣasā sūryeṇa cāśvinā tiroahnyam
Like a ray they have smitten what lay in the way; the black-steed who listens, borne by the charioteer chosen. With the company of dawn, of Ushas, of Surya — the Ashvins crossed the shore at daybreak.
Humblers of the pride (of your enemies), seize the sacrifices of Śyāvāśva offering libations as youseize your reins; and united with the dawn and with Sūrya, (drink), Aśvins,(the Soma) prepared the previousday.
Seize, as ye grasp the reins, Syavasva's solemn rites who presses out the Soma, ye who reel in joy. Accordant, of one mind with Surya and with Dawn, drink juice, O Asvins, three days old.
